The Hidden Waterfalls Tour has this name for a good reason. An experience that is truly off the beaten track, we estimate that less than 300 travelers have ever visited this undiscovered part of El Salvador.
Your tour guide will be clearing a path with his machete as he/she stops to teach you about the medicinal and edible plants that the local people…

An adventure of a lifetime - This was the most exhilarating day trip that we have done as a family. William and Edwin the guides were amazing and fun. We had such a great day (although absolutely exhausting). The scenery is breathtaking and the waterfalls were refreshing. It was at the limit of my fitness level but our older teens had no problems and absolutely loved the entire experience. Parts of it were tough going for our 10 year old daughter but William and Edwin couldn’t have been nicer. There is rappelling and a lot of rock climbing, steep walks through the jungle and swimming. They taught us about all the various plants and their uses and even found us wild mangoes and plenty of other fruits I had never heard of to taste along the way. I couldn’t recommend this highly enough - it was so peaceful and is so much fun for those with an adventurous spirit. Recommendations - What you need 1) put on bug spray and sunscreen before you leave. Would bring a small bug spray just in case (we didn’t get bitten) 2) swim suit and cover that is good for hiking, protects you from sun and that you can swim in 3) hiking shoes that will get wet (grip is important) - you will swim with these on and it was much easier than I thought 4) 1L water for each person 5 ) optional sun hat 6) optional protein bar 7) optional small waterproof back pack - we didn’t have this so they took ours and put it in theirs for the part that we needed to swim in river 8) camera/ phone to take photos ( will need to go in the guides waterproof bag at some point) What you don’t need 1) flip flops or any kind of flimsy footwear 2) we brought towels but didn’t need them - (although no harm to bring a small towel and dry top for a younger child) 3) jackets/ coats/ change of clothes 4) breakfast or lunch as they are included in the trip - unless you have dietary requirements - vegan friendly options 5) anything you won’t be able to carry for a few hours hike 6) hiking poles as plenty of natural ones along the way
